Why Jasper? The Metaphysical Anchoring Stone

Jasper is revered in crystal healing circles as a stone of grounding, stability, and emotional renewal. Its name derives from the Greek “iaspis”, meaning “spotted stone,” reflecting its uniquely patterned appearance formed over millennia.
